Job Expectations:
The QA Technician will perform Quality and Food Safety tests, checks and audits as assigned to ensure the quality and food safety of all raw, in process and finished goods. S/he will accurately complete and enter electronically all required safety, quality and manufacturing control documents and information.

 Maintains, cleans, and calibrates laboratory equipment according to specified schedules.
 Conducts sample preparation and testing at specified stages in the production process for a variety of characteristics and specifications. Must be able to inspect product using sensory abilities. Accurately logs samples and enters test results in ERP system. Maintains all records and retention samples.
 Understanding and identification of non-conforming raw materials, semi-finished and finished goods. Completes HOLD document in database and places materials on hold physically and in the ERP system for further evaluation. Timely reports non-conformances and issues identified during quality activities to the Quality Manager.
 Ability to organize and prioritize work.
 Maintains inventory of supplies and restocks supplies as needed.
 Utilizes experience, skills, and training to manage any quality issues that arise on respective shift.
 Assists with training new laboratory personnel.
 Lead and/or participates in plant internal audit program or GMPs walk throughs.
 Understands and adheres to Good Manufacturing Practices and Good Laboratory Practices.
 Aids the Quality Manager and Operations with customer complaint investigations as needed.
 Verifies sanitation changeovers as required.
 Performs environmental sampling and prepares samples for temperature sensitive shipments to 3rd party laboratory.
